fqdn:8082 changes to localhost:8082 on its own

Hope I'm in the right forum because I can't replicate it anywhere else.

Fresh install of CiviCRM on Acquia DAMP stack. Flawless so far. However, navigating in any browser (IE-FF-Chrome) from either server or client workstation to the "View and Edit Custom Fields" page of CiviCRM changes the FQDN to localhost and cant be found.

http://servername.domainname.local:8082/civicrm/admin/custom/group&reset=1

changes to

http://localhost:8082/civicrm/admin/custom/group&reset=1

Ah ha!

civicrm.setting.php

CIVICRM_UF_BASEURL was set to localhost
